Aging during Phase Separation in Long-Range Ising Model (2304.04996v1)

Published 11 Apr 2023 in cond-mat.stat-mech

Abstract: The kinetics of domain growth and aging in conserved order parameter systems, in the presence of short-range interaction, is widely studied. Due to technical difficulties and lack of resources, regarding computation, the dynamics is still not well established in the cases where long-range interactions are involved. Here we present related results from the Monte Carlo simulations of the two-dimensional long-range Ising model (LRIM). Random initial configurations, for $50:50$ compositions of up and down spins, mimicking high temperature equilibrium states, have been quenched to temperatures inside the coexistence curve. Our analysis of the simulation data, for such a protocol, shows interesting dependence of the aging exponent, $\lambda$, on $\sigma$, the parameter, within the Hamiltonian, that controls the range of interaction. To complement these results, we also discuss simulation outcomes for the growth exponent. The obtained values of $\lambda$ are compared with a well-known result for the lower bounds. For this purpose we have extracted interesting properties of the evolving structure.
